| A forgotten lifetime compels me to seek you out Your form most precious Liquid, sinew, muscle, flesh Transformed by some clever alchemy From human to divine Your body torrid, untamed Filled by an easy grace Summons such ecstacy From its secret home As I have only dreamed As I have never known. For Armand.. March 18th 2001 |

| Crushed leaves a pillow for his head The breeze a blanket for his bed Death fades the lines of pain and hate Smoothes like a babe who'll soon awake But yet he slumbers, does not stir As though in dreams quite unaware No breath lifts up his chest so smooth No heartbeat urges him to move. His parted lips await the taste To lift him from the human race Cold marble lover looming near Embrace the night. Your fate lays here. Completed March 14th 2001 |
